Sheet metal decoilers are essential components of material handling systems used in various industries, including automotive, construction, and manufacturing. These machines play a crucial role in unwinding and feeding sheet metal coils into production processes, ensuring efficient and safe material handling. Here’s how sheet metal decoilers improve material handling:
Improved Productivity
Automated Coil Handling
Sheet metal decoilers automate the process of unwinding and feeding coils, eliminating manual handling and increasing productivity. This reduces the risk of workplace injuries and speeds up production processes.
Continuous Operation
Decoilers allow for continuous operation by automatically feeding material into the production line. This eliminates downtime associated with coil changes, keeping production lines running smoothly.
Enhanced Safety
Reduced Manual Labor
Automated decoilers reduce the need for manual labor, minimizing the risk of workplace accidents and injuries. Operators are not required to handle heavy coils manually, which can lead to musculoskeletal disorders.
Coil Containment
Decoilers keep coils securely contained, preventing them from uncoiling uncontrollably and posing a safety hazard. This containment feature ensures a safe working environment for operators.
Improved Material Quality
Tension Control
Decoilers provide precise tension control during the unwinding process, ensuring that the material is fed into the production line at the correct tension. This prevents material damage, such as wrinkles or stretching.
Surface Protection
Decoil lines are equipped with devices that protect the surface of the metal during the unwinding process. These devices prevent scratches or other damage that could affect the material’s quality.
Reduced Waste
Precise tension control and automated coil handling minimize the risk of material damage and defects, reducing waste and improving material utilization.
